QStorageInfo/Linux: resolve non-existent devices via /dev/block

On systems with very simple boot sequences, the kernel will create a
device called /dev/root and use that to mount the root filesystem.
However, that doesn't actually exist in /dev and could cause
confusion. So we try to resolve using /dev/block if the /dev entry does
not exist but udev is in use (udevd has the string "/dev/%s/%u:%u").

[ChangeLog][QtCore][QStorageInfo] Improved discovery of device nodes on
Linux if the /dev entry was renamed after the filesystem was mounted and
udev is in use.

@ -566,6 +566,21 @@ inline QByteArray QStorageIterator::fileSystemType() const
inline QByteArray QStorageIterator::device() const
{
// check that the device exists
if (mnt.mnt_fsname[0] == '/' && access(mnt.mnt_fsname, F_OK) != 0) {
// It doesn't, so let's try to resolve the dev_t from /dev/block.
// Note how strlen("4294967295") == digits10 + 1, so we need to add 1
// for each number, plus the ':'.
char buf[sizeof("/dev/block/") + 2 * std::numeric_limits<unsigned>::digits10 + 3];
QByteArray dev(PATH_MAX, Qt::Uninitialized);
char *devdata = dev.data();
snprintf(buf, sizeof(buf), "/dev/block/%u:%u", major(mnt.rdev), minor(mnt.rdev));
if (realpath(buf, devdata)) {
dev.truncate(strlen(devdata));
return dev;
}
}
return QByteArray(mnt.mnt_fsname);
}
